There are many causes of blurred vision, generally related to visual fatigue, eye infection, cataract, glaucoma and so on.
1. Visual fatigue: If patients use their eyes for a long time at close range, their eyes can not get rest, which leads to ciliary muscle spasm, and thus patients can experience blurred vision.
2. Eye infection: due to bacteria, viruses, mycoplasma and other pathogens caused by conjunctivitis, conjunctivitis, uveitis and other diseases patients, under the stimulation of inflammation, eye secretions increase, secretions cover the cornea or sclera, the patient may appear blurred vision symptoms.
3. Cataract: aging, diabetes, trauma and other factors cause metabolic disorders of the lens, lens protein degeneration and clouding, patients may experience blurred vision.
4. Glaucoma: patients with glaucoma may suffer from eye distension, vomiting, blurred vision and other symptoms due to increased intraocular pressure, compression of the optic nerve or corneal edema.
It is recommended that patients with blurred vision consult a doctor promptly to assess their condition and follow the doctor’s instructions for treatment.
